How can I give someone rights = to Administrator?
Example:
I created a user called "Jo".
I made her an "Administrator".

However, When I try to install programs I get a message that said she does
not have the right's to install.

My goal is to make the user/owner of the computer to have the same rights as
Administrator.

Is this posible?
WinXP Pro.

Thank you.

Control panel, administrative tools, computer management local users &
groups - make sure she's in the Administrators group. If she is, something
else is afoot.
